The Republican
talking machine is preoccupied with the Supreme Court ruling that Obamacare is
legal because of the TAX. While the
same provision in Romneycare is termed a penalty, according to Fox and other
Republican talking heads, Obamacare is “the largest tax ever imposed upon
Americans”. While Fox assumes their
viewers are incapable of reading a 2000 plus page of legislation and while
Senator Rubio also appears incapable of reading the law, lets talk a closer
look at this so-called tax. To begin
with, why does it matter what term is used to describe the tax, fee, penalty,
or what ever? For one thing, is does
not apply to everyone. If an individual
already has and keeps in place healthcare insurance there is no tax, fee,
penalty, or whatever (TFPW) imposed. In
addition, if an individual does not make enough money to afford to buy
healthcare on his (or her) own and is not provided healthcare insurance by his
(or her) employer there is no TFPW.
Finally, if an individual does have employer provided healthcare
insurance there is no TFPW. That brings
us to the actual implementation of the TFPW.
Only an individual with sufficient annual income to afford to purchase
healthcare insurance but refused to do so will be subject to this TFPW. However (and this is the most important
“but”) the legislation specifically prohibits any department of the government
including the IRS from taking any measures to collect this tax. So, instead of the “largest tax increase
ever imposed upon Americans” this is truly a Nancy Regan tax... “Just Say No”
if you are one of the 1% that ends up having a TFPW levied. Republicans should love this form of
tax...one owes the tax but refuses to pay the tax and the government can do
nothing to collect it! This has to be a
Republican creation so why do they oppose it?
